Sql Server Restore Transaction Log
You’ll discover the granting of permissions on the schema degree in the last lesson of this module. Recovery is an important aspect of information Availability. SQL Transaction log backup permits you to back up your transaction logs on a regular basis assembly recovery point goals . This offers not only database restoration choices, but also point-in-time database recovery.
With our multi-thread and block-level incremental backup technologies, CloudBacko Pro is ready to shortly backup large SQL databases to your native and offsite storage. The purpose for there being 3 varieties aren’t immediately apparent however understanding them is essential to having an excellent backup technique inside your system. These are additionally related to the Recovery Mode of your databases. It is straightforward to become overwhelmed by the quantity of output that monitoring tools can present, so that you additionally need to study techniques for analyzing their output. Use custom database roles and utility roles to handle database-level safety.
- Need to backup databases corresponding to Microsoft SQL Server or MySQL?
- My message is that your restore technique ought to dictate your backup method.
- There are two ways through which the database backup may be taken, first one is by using SQL Server Management Studio and the second one is by utilizing T-SQL instructions.
- But what do you do when you simply have a folder full of random information from a number of databases from a quantity of days with a combination of full, differential and transaction backups?
In this module, you will think about tips on how to create a technique that is aligned with organizational wants, based on the out there backup models, and the function of the transaction logs in sustaining database consistency. For the remaining 5% we labored out per server home windows and now we don’t see the problem on any of our servers. Peer Point can run differential and incremental log backup of Exchange Server. This is useful to maintain the number incremental log files beneath limit and yet not having to run full backups frequently.
Enterprise Telecoms
To permit log information to be released and the log to be truncated, you must again up the transaction log. If the log has by no means been backed up, you should create two log backups to permit the Database Engine to truncate the log to the last backup point. Truncating the log makes logical space out there for brand new log records. Take log backups on a regular and extra frequent basis to keep the log from filling up once more. ‘Best Practice’ dictates keeping logs and information recordsdata on separate methods, otherwise when you lose the disk then you have to face manually re-entering all the information for the reason that last database backup. When your frustration wears off you could resolve from that day ahead to at all times look after the logs.
That’s why you sometimes get an alert of transaction hindrance, highlighting inadequate area within the transaction log or the drive the place the log is stored. So my message is control these transaction logs both during the backup and if you end up about to restore knowledge. Restoring is the process of copying information from a backup and making use of logged transactions to the data. These backup the transaction logs which are stored independently of the information. The major concern with encrypting backup is that without the certificates that was used within the database backup, it is impossible to revive the backup. Therefore, the certificates must be backed up and saved safely off the server.
• Provided 24 X 7 dedicated help for SQL Server production server. Trigger can be overkill as 1) it’s one-time factor, 2) the data is already placed. It’s potential that the appending data has brought on the differential to be greater. Further, I authorise Insoft Ltd. processing, utilizing accumulating and storing my personal knowledge for the aim of these actions.
Are Your Sql Servers Healthy?
You can also use the aggregator web site for getting details like greatest value prices and deal. Backup server and retrieve the same when authentic knowledge endure from damages or destructions. Ransomware ProtectionHave versatile versioning to access data from any time. As mentioned in the above table, SID, XACTID and SPID are solely logged at the beginning or on the end of the transaction.
LiveVault is ready to defend Microsoft SQL databases constantly, significantly lowering the vulnerability of business knowledge throughout the day. LiveVault strongly recommends that customers use the LiveVault service to protect their SQL database and transaction logs, however not the database backups. This is as a outcome of LiveVault is ready to defend the database itself extraordinarily effectively, transferring only byte- stage changes as they occur. As talked about above, you cannot perform transaction log backups on a database in SIMPLE recovery mode. If you want to change the restoration mannequin of the database, you’ll be able to run the under script to vary the recovery mannequin of the database from SIMPLE to FULL. The transaction log backup job runs permanently within the background, shipping transaction logs to the backup repository at a selected time interval .
Full Restoration Mannequin
You can recuperate the data quickly and exactly from the servers. Unlike other backup servers, you can store your priceless enterprise information in multiple storage areas and retrieve it when the need arises. IT system administrators and others can achieve immediate entry to anetwork folderand validate the info at any point in time.
All was going well till I accidentally highlighted half of the UPDATE and one temporary F5 press later I was very stunned to read that I had “Successfully up to date 1.5 million rows”. “When on the lookout for a backup answer for a Linux server, we tried Duplicati, Veeam and a pair others. CloudBacko was the only one that worked as advertised, out of the box.” Another one to offsite storage, either your FTP/SFTP server or one other non-Microsoft cloud storage, as an additional safety. This module describes the means to use SQL Server Profiler and SQL Trace saved procedures to seize details about SQL Server, and how to use that information to troubleshoot and optimize SQL Server workloads.
In this module, you’ll contemplate how to create a strategy that is aligned with organisational wants, primarily based on the obtainable backup fashions, and the role of the transaction logs in maintaining database consistency. One of crucial elements of a database administrator’s role is guaranteeing that organizational knowledge is reliably backed up in order that, if a failure happens, you can recuperate the info. A further downside is that, even when the strategies in place work as they have been designed, the outcomes still frequently fail to satisfy an organization’s operational necessities.
The major problemwith CDC enabled databases is that the KEEP_CDC option is incompatible with the NORECOVERY option. With over 300 years of mixed experience in Microsoft business options, our team will assist to get you up and operating, as nicely as constructing a partnership that keeps you supported, all from our UK workplaces. With an interest in doing one thing inventive every day, Sonam works as a Digital Marketing Executive.
In DZone’s 2019 Guide to Databases, 98% of developer survey respondents said their organizations use relational databases frequently, which incessantly depend on SQL to question the data. With Oak Academy programs on SQL, you probably can learn one of the most in-demand skills for professions ranging from product managers to marketers to software program engineers. One of crucial roles of a database administrator is to continuously shield the integrity of the databases and keep the ability to recuperate shortly in case of a failure. In light of this, it’s critically important to have a backup-and-recovery strategy in place to have the ability to be prepared for an emergency. You’re about to re initialise the whole Log Shipping plan which is a real killer as this database is a monster! Then you cease, you assume and remember, did not I learn somewhere that a differential backup will bridge that LSN gap?
Backing up databases individually provides higher storage management flexibility. For example, important databases may be backed up extra frequently. However, once you have specified this standby file, it can be tough in finding out what the file is called, and the place it is on your disk. There isn’t any property of a database that exposes this information, and nothing in any of the regular DMVs that you simply would possibly suppose would provide this up.
Our managed backup system offers you full peace of mind that your small business is protected. No matter how cautious or experienced you’re at SQL Server development, there’ll inevitably be instances if you run a question that you just really wish you had not run. I was working on a project recently for a shopper and hacking round with my local growth surroundings to try to quick monitor a piece of performance. The hack concerned updating a sequence of rows in a 1,500,000 row table and I was executing a sequence of UPDATEs in SQL Management studio as a result of I didn’t need to waste time writing an admin script to do it.
Another good tactic is to take the total backup once more which will be used as the bottom for differential backup. The restoration course of within the RESTORE reads the log file and brings the database on-line in a transactionally consistent state by undoing transactions that aren’t committed. Doing this nonetheless, breaks the log chain and would stop you from making use of any further transaction logs. IDERA’s SQL Safe Backup supplies a high-performance backup and restoration answer for Microsoft SQL Server. SQL Safe Backup saves cash by decreasing database backup time by as much as 50% over native backups and decreasing backup disk space necessities by as a lot as 95%.
When you make a full backup of the logs, then truncating these logs is appropriate – you might have all the data within the tapes. On the other hand with just a full backup of the database however incomplete logs your restore will be out-of-date. To perceive backup you want to remember of the position of log information in a restore. What you find out about SQL write ahead logs can be utilized to different databases corresponding to Active Directory and change. You must deal with this the identical as someone dropping your database – go to the latest full database backup you have after which restore all subsequent log backups. Restore transaction log with standby possibility leaves the database learn only mode.
Restored Easy Restoration Mannequin
Describe SQL Server services and how you handle the configuration of those providers. Jet Reports, Sharperlight, BI360, Power BI or different external reporting software program – The reports ought to be positioned in a folder that is included within the nightly system backup. Integration Manager – The .mdb or .imd file accommodates the integrations and must be included in the nightly system backup. • Tuned saved procedures, triggers, views and adding/changing tables for knowledge load and transformation, and data extraction.
Once you might have taken a backup of the database it’s fairly a simple task to revive a database. First we do our regular setup, loading the SMO module and creating some primary objects. Next we set the name of the database we’re restoring, and in addition tell our $Restore object that we don’t want to get well the database at the end of the Restore . This 3 day course is meant for students who have to study the essential skills essential to maintain a Microsoft SQL Server 2016 or 2017 system infrastructure.
Read more about https://www.datraction.co.uk/server-data-recovery/ here.